Ottimizzazione delle prestazioni del computer

Che cos’è l’utilizzo della CPU?

L’utilizzo della CPU si riferisce alla quantità di potenza di elaborazione utilizzata da un computer per eseguire i programmi. Può essere misurato in termini di percentuale della potenza di elaborazione totale utilizzata. Un utilizzo elevato della CPU può portare a un computer lento e può essere indice di un problema.

Identificare l’uso elevato della CPU

L’uso elevato della CPU è solitamente causato da un programma che esegue troppi processi o utilizza troppa memoria. Identificare il programma che sta causando l’utilizzo elevato della CPU può essere difficile, ma ci sono alcuni passi da fare per determinare il colpevole.

Ottimizzazione dei programmi di avvio

I programmi di avvio sono programmi che vengono lanciati automaticamente all’avvio del computer. Un numero eccessivo di questi programmi può causare un elevato utilizzo della CPU e rallentare il computer. È possibile ottimizzare i programmi di avvio disabilitando quelli non necessari.

Aumentare la memoria virtuale

La memoria virtuale è un tipo di memoria utilizzata dal computer per memorizzare i dati quando non è in uso. Se il computer ha poca memoria virtuale, può causare un elevato utilizzo della CPU. Aumentare la quantità di memoria virtuale può aiutare a liberare l’uso della CPU.

Chiudere i processi non necessari

A volte i programmi possono eseguire processi non necessari che possono causare un elevato utilizzo della CPU. È possibile chiudere questi processi per liberare l’uso della CPU.

Reinstallare il software problematico

Se si sta eseguendo un programma che causa un elevato utilizzo della CPU, si può provare a reinstallarlo per vedere se il problema si risolve.

Aggiornamento dei driver

Anche i driver obsoleti possono causare un elevato utilizzo della CPU. L’aggiornamento dei driver può aiutare a liberare l’utilizzo della CPU.

Usare Resource Monitor

Resource Monitor è uno strumento che può aiutare a identificare e monitorare i programmi che causano un elevato utilizzo della CPU.

Esecuzione di una scansione del malware

Anche il malware può causare un elevato utilizzo della CPU. L’esecuzione di una scansione del malware può aiutare a liberare l’uso della CPU rimuovendo il software dannoso.

Conclusione

L’utilizzo elevato della CPU può portare a un computer lento, ma ci sono misure che si possono adottare per liberare l’utilizzo della CPU. L’ottimizzazione dei programmi di avvio, l’aumento della memoria virtuale, la chiusura dei processi non necessari, la reinstallazione di software problematici, l’aggiornamento dei driver, l’uso di Resource Monitor e l’esecuzione di una scansione del malware possono contribuire a liberare l’uso della CPU e a migliorare le prestazioni del computer.

FAQ
Il 90% di utilizzo della CPU va bene?

La risposta breve è che il 90% di utilizzo della CPU probabilmente va bene, ma potrebbero esserci dei problemi di fondo che causano questo livello di utilizzo.

Se l’utilizzo della CPU è regolarmente pari o vicino al 90%, è bene indagare sulle cause. Potrebbe trattarsi di un singolo processo che sta utilizzando molte risorse della CPU, oppure potrebbe essere che il sistema sia semplicemente sovraccaricato dal carico di lavoro.

Ci sono alcune cose che si possono fare per restringere la causa dell’elevato utilizzo della CPU:

– Controllare il task manager o il monitor delle attività per vedere quali processi utilizzano maggiormente le risorse della CPU.

– Se si utilizza Windows, è possibile utilizzare lo strumento Resource Monitor per ottenere informazioni più dettagliate sui processi che utilizzano le risorse della CPU.

– Se si utilizza un Mac, è possibile utilizzare lo strumento Monitoraggio attività per ottenere informazioni più dettagliate sui processi che utilizzano le risorse della CPU.

– Provare a riprodurre il problema durante l’esecuzione di uno strumento di monitoraggio dell’utilizzo della CPU come Process Explorer (Windows) o Activity Monitor (Mac) per ottenere informazioni più dettagliate sui processi che utilizzano le risorse della CPU.

Una volta identificata la causa dell’elevato utilizzo della CPU, è possibile adottare misure per risolverla. Ad esempio, se l’utilizzo elevato della CPU è dovuto a un processo che sta utilizzando molte risorse della CPU, si può provare a chiudere il processo o a riavviare il computer. Se l’utilizzo elevato della CPU è dovuto a un sistema che viene sottoposto a un carico di lavoro eccessivo, si può provare a ridurre il carico di lavoro o ad aggiungere più risorse al sistema.

Perché il mio sistema utilizza il 50% della CPU?

Ci sono alcuni motivi potenziali per cui il sistema potrebbe utilizzare il 50% della CPU:

1. Potreste avere molti programmi aperti contemporaneamente, che causano un picco nell’utilizzo della CPU.

2. Un programma potrebbe eseguire un processo che utilizza molte risorse della CPU.

3. La CPU potrebbe essere surriscaldata, il che può indurla a ridurre le prestazioni per evitare danni.

Se non siete sicuri di cosa stia causando un utilizzo così elevato della CPU, potete usare un programma come Task Manager per aiutarvi a capirlo. Task Manager mostra quali processi utilizzano maggiormente le risorse della CPU. Se vedete un processo che non riconoscete o che sta usando molte risorse, potete fare una ricerca per vedere se è qualcosa che dovete eseguire.

Come si imposta l’utilizzo massimo della CPU al 99%?

Ci sono diversi modi per farlo, ma il più semplice è usare il Task Manager di Windows.

1. Fare clic con il pulsante destro del mouse sulla barra delle applicazioni di Windows e selezionare “Task Manager”

2. Selezionare la scheda “Processi”. Selezionare la scheda “Processi”

3. Individuare il processo che si desidera limitare nell’elenco dei processi

4. Fare clic con il pulsante destro del mouse sul processo e selezionare “Imposta affinità”

5. Nella finestra di dialogo “Imposta affinità”, deselezionare tutte le caselle ad eccezione di un core della CPU

6. Fare clic su “OK”

7. Fare clic su “OK”

8. Fare clic su “OK”

9. Fare clic su “OK”

10. Fare clic su “OK”. Fare clic su “OK”

7. Nella finestra di Task Manager, fare clic sulla scheda “Dettagli”

8. Individuare il processo appena modificato nella finestra di Task Manager. Individuare il processo appena modificato nell’elenco dei processi

9. Fare clic con il pulsante destro del mouse sul processo e selezionare la voce “Processo”. Fare clic con il pulsante destro del mouse sul processo e selezionare “Imposta priorità”

10. Nella finestra di dialogo “Imposta priorità”, fare clic su “Imposta priorità”. Nella finestra di dialogo “Imposta priorità”, selezionare “In tempo reale” dal menu a discesa

11. Fare clic su “OK”

Si può modificare il processo in base alle proprie esigenze.

11. Fare clic su “OK”

È inoltre possibile utilizzare l’Editor del Registro di sistema per impostare l’utilizzo massimo della CPU per un processo.

1. Premere il tasto Windows + R per aprire la finestra di dialogo Esegui

2. Digitare “regedit” e premere il tasto “Esegui”. Digitare “regedit” e premere Invio

3. Navigare fino alla seguente chiave: H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lPriorityControl

4. Fare doppio clic sul valore “Win32PrioritySeparation”

5. Modificare il valore da 18 a 2 e modificare il valore di “Win32PrioritySeparation”. Modificare il valore da 18 a 2 e fare clic su “OK”

6. Chiudere l’Editor del Registro di sistema

7. Chiudere l’Editor del Registro di sistema

7. Riavviare il computer